How Water Damage Restoration Actually Works

When you call us for water damage restoration, our team will arrive quickly and assess the situation. We'll identify the source of the water, whether it's a burst pipe, a roof leak, or something else, and develop a plan to extract water dry out the area, and repair any damage.

Step 1: Assess and Plan

Our team will arrive and assess the situation, identifying the source of the water and the extent of the damage. We'll develop a plan to extract water, dry out the area, and repair any damage. This step is crucial in determining the best course of action and ensuring that the restoration process is completed efficiently.

Step 2: Extract Water

Using advanced equipment, our team will extract water from the affected area, reducing damage to your property. We'll remove standing water and dry out the area, using techniques such as wet vacuuming and dehumidification.

Step 3: Dry Out the Area

Once the water has been ext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ry out the area, including fans, dehumidifiers, and air movers.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ring that your property is safe and dry.

Step 4: Repair Damage

Finally, our team will repair any damage to your property, including walls, floors, and ceilings. We'll replace damaged materials and install new fixtures to ensure that your property is safe and functional.

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a pipe under the sink Yes No Easy to fix with basic tools and knowledge.
Widespread flooding in a basement No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ely extract water and dry out the area.
Water damage from a burst pipe in a ceiling No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ely extract water and repair damage to the ceiling and walls.
Musty odors in a crawl space No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ely extract water and repair damage to the crawl space.
Water damage from a roof leak No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ely extract water and repair damage to the roof and walls.
Small water stain on a wall Yes No Easy to fix with basic tools and knowledge.

Water Damage Restoration Cost In Peoria, AZ

The cost of water damage restoration in Peoria, AZ can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Get a free estimate today and let us help you understand the costs involved.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 - $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Repair and replacement of damaged materials $2,000 - $10,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of materials damaged.
Disinfection and sanitizing $500 - $2,000 Size of affected area and severity of damage.
Moisture testing and inspection $200 - $1,000 Size of affected area and severity of damage.

How do I prevent water damage?

Preventing water damage is easier than you think. Regular maintenance of your plumbing and roof, inspecting for signs of damage, and acting quickly when you notice a problem can help prevent water damage.
